The City of Kitchener is committed to the inclusion of children and youth with disabilities in municipal recreation programs. Through Inclusion Services, people with disabilities receive support from inclusion support workers to assist with their participation at municipal recreation programs.
As an Inclusion Support Coordinator, you will oversee numerous support placements across Kitchener, ensuring that your team is equipped with the information, skills, and supplies that they need to provide the unique support required.
